龍神
|
發表於 2008-10-14 02:58 AM |
根據樓主的意思,其它的辯論懶的去看>.<
很簡單的道理,各位有空就去實驗看看就知道
拿一個最常見的XVID格式的動畫,前提你們要先搞清楚你的DVD播放機支援到多少畫素,例如640*480
有些畫素高出播放機的支援度,播放機畫面會出不來....
也有就是你播出來要有畫面跟聲音,不要用到有聲無影或有影無聲
把它拆成一個影像+一個音頻,最好是壓成常見的MP3格式==>封成MKV,再改副檔名AVI
丟進去能播且聲音有出來,代表該播機只要有他支援的CODE及畫素都OK
若都播不出來,代表該播放機不支援MKV這個規格
以上
改副檔名的方式,在電腦上如果都是同一個軟體在跑,沒意義
為何各位不會JPG ===> TXT 或者 AVI ===> TXT
看會怎麼樣????
[龍神 在 2008-10-13 08:07 AM 作了最後編輯]
| |
NeoBetas
|
發表於 2008-10-13 10:48 AM |
MKV裡面裝了不少東西...能不能撥要看你的播放器能不能處理裡面的東西,和能不能從單一MKV封裝裡面把他們辨別出來。
Win下可不可以分辨我不清楚,但在Mac下VLC不管你有沒有附檔名或是你附檔名改甚麼,他能撥就是能撥,不能就是不能。
| |
陽だまり
|
發表於 2008-10-13 04:01 AM |
MKV和AVI的檔案編碼不同
直接把MKV格式的影音檔改副檔名變成AVI要給DVD撥放器
如果撥放器不能撥MKV的話,當然還是不行撥
也有可能,就算撥放器能撥MKV
但因為以副檔名來做優先判斷,則造成使用錯誤的解碼器來撥
所以還是不給撥
--
老實說,不太了解之前的在聊什麼
比較嚴謹的撥放器的話,會依影音檔的檔頭來判別該影音檔要用什麼解碼器來撥
比較隨性的撥放器就會依副檔名來決定用什麼來解碼這樣
但不管嚴謹還是隨性,不同的解碼配上不對的影音檔都是不能撥就是了
不知我這樣說有沒有錯
| |
平凡小任
|
發表於 2008-10-12 11:36 PM |
基本上你把在電腦上編碼的知識套用到機器
我覺得是差滿多的
老實說我也看不懂你那實驗代表的涵義
是要模擬pc環境呢又不像
要模擬機器呢也不像
我還是看不出跟懂很多編碼知識有何相關
至於mkv放入tmpegenc當掉
這我倒沒遇過
不過我也不知道講這個跟標題有何相關
我覺得我弄那個跑假mkv然後haali跑出來鬧反而證明了個人的容器說
因為haali之前跟mkv關聯到
事實上haali應該是相當優異的mkv分離器
這在論壇某篇有遇到過haali的問題
不管怎麼講
你跟我都沒看過樓主的機器
也沒辦法評斷
現在機器日新月異
我反而相信他會越來越接近pc環境
畢竟很多韌體都能更新
以上我講的我還是認為不需要懂什麼編碼有的沒的
因為我們只要會用會看就好了
要制定那些也輪不到我們來制定
而且說別人要補充基本知識感覺是有點臭屁
而且我看了那麼多也沒看到什麼基本的
我不敢說編碼這個我很懂
可是我也不敢隨便路上跟別人說某某某你去補充些基本的知識我們再來聊
你會不會以為自己真是資優班的老師阿
我突然覺得頭有點暈暈的了...
[平凡小任 在 2008-10-12 11:42 PM 作了最後編輯]
| |
froce
|
發表於 2008-10-12 11:27 PM |
引用: 平凡小任寫到:
再封裝?
假設你本來包的檔案播放器就有支援
再封裝有意思嗎?→依據播放器只是一個容器這樣的觀點
當然有...
你要正確的改封裝格式就得靠這樣的動作...而不是改副檔名...
看來你沒遇到過mkv放到TMPGEnc因為haali當掉的情況...
引用:
呵呵
我只講我看到的情形
我也提出你的乾淨環境不等於播放器的論點
我不認為要提這個跟要搞懂什麼容器什麼有的沒有的有關
請問關係在哪?
[平凡小任 在 2008-10-12 11:21 PM 作了最後編輯]
因為這些東西是討論影片編碼的基本...
你連基本都沒搞懂...那寫出來的東西會有可信度嗎?...
---
一樣...我不打算繼續浪費口水在上面了...
我寫的東西有遺漏或錯誤...要補充的請儘量補充...
[froce 在 2008-10-12 11:30 PM 作了最後編輯]
| |
平凡小任
|
發表於 2008-10-12 11:19 PM |
再封裝?
假設你本來包的檔案播放器就有支援
再封裝有意思嗎?→依據附檔名只是一個容器這樣的觀點
呵呵
我只講我看到的情形
我也提出你的乾淨環境不等於播放器的論點
我不認為要提這個跟要搞懂什麼容器什麼有的沒有的有關
請問關係在哪?
之所以會有我本來是mkv
我想改附檔名直接給機器吃這樣的想法
其實說穿了就是機器只吃固定格式
沒pc那樣活而已
一般牽涉到機器就有所謂的轉檔
只是作為容器理論
我覺得改檔名可行
不過要看內容物是什麼
這應該跟我本來的講法不相違背才是
[平凡小任 在 2008-10-12 11:26 PM 作了最後編輯]
| |
froce
|
發表於 2008-10-12 11:16 PM |
引用: 平凡小任寫到:
mkv裡包羅萬象
不過我有看過一個單檔的
這時候解封裝就無意義了
當然你也可以說一個單檔的mkv也沒什麼意思
不過我有抓過就是了
不知道你有沒有看到"再封裝"這3個字...
引用:
另外
我講過了阿
kmplayer播放mkv時haali跑出來鬧→即便是我之前wmv改的
這表示這個檔案有經過haali的檢查
不能說改檔無意義
只能說是否關聯到
沒關聯當然無意義
有關聯反之
[平凡小任 在 2008-10-12 11:12 PM 作了最後編輯]
上面也解釋過了...
拜託你去把codec、splitter、容器、rendering path這些基本的名詞搞懂一點...
要談我們再繼續談下去吧...
| |
平凡小任
|
發表於 2008-10-12 11:10 PM |
mkv裡包羅萬象
不過我有看過只包一個單檔的
這時候解封裝就無意義了
當然你也可以說一個單檔的mkv也沒什麼意思
不過我有抓過就是了
另外
我講過了阿
kmplayer播放mkv時haali跑出來鬧→即便是我之前wmv改的
這表示這個檔案有經過haali的檢查
不能說改檔無意義
只能說是否關聯到
沒關聯當然無意義
有關聯反之
另外系統關聯為何會無意義
系統關聯就是為了讓你開檔案時系統能用最好最適合的軟體開啟或播放
我覺得是有意義的
如果你設定錯誤
他還會跳出方框要你選正確的程式開啟
只是我們現在播放器很多都是萬用的
容錯性相當高
[平凡小任 在 2008-10-12 11:16 PM 作了最後編輯]
| |
froce
|
發表於 2008-10-12 11:02 PM |
引用: 平凡小任寫到:
我在pc上做試驗是表示說這檔案在pc上可行
並不是說要在播放器使用
而且我的做法在顯現pc的強大而跟一般播放器無涉
一般播放器是固定的東西很難一直隨時間改進演化
測不能播放的東西個人反而覺得沒什麼意思
因為你的乾淨系統仍然不能等於一般播放器阿
又要loop了嗎?...
我再說一遍...事實上你的系統還是把這個假AVI當mkv來播放...
所以能播放...
這表示你這個把mkv改副檔名這個動作是無意義的...
乾淨系統的實驗正是要證明這點...
跟系統關聯一點關係都沒有...
系統關聯只負責把檔案類型丟給指定的軟體...
而播放軟體找codecs是看MIME type或是檔頭的...
---
正確的作法我剛剛也有提到...
你可以先把mkv解封裝出來...再封裝到其他的容器去...
[froce 在 2008-10-12 11:05 PM 作了最後編輯]
| |
平凡小任
|
發表於 2008-10-12 10:55 PM |
那個可能性是有可是太低了
你想想
會有廠商賣只能播放自己機子demo的機器嗎?
至於用自帶codec的軟體很正常阿
而且我用的都是綠色免安裝版
有沒有跟windows關聯到就不知道了
總之你怎麼在自己電腦模擬都沒有用
因為沒辦法等於播放器的實際環境
我只知道播放器很挑
因為我實際有且做過實驗
附檔名改掉就吃不到了→看的到檔,可是按下去什麼都沒有,本來可以播放的變不能播放
當然我還是得強調
這是在我的播放器
sigma的古老晶片
[平凡小任 在 2008-10-12 11:02 PM 作了最後編輯]
| |
本主題回覆較多,請 點擊這裡 檢閱。 |